DateTime::Duration is just a hash that looks like this:

$VAR1 = bless( {
                 'seconds' => 20,
                 'minutes' => 106,
                 'end_of_month' => 'wrap',
                 'nanoseconds' => 0,
                 'days' => 8,
                 'months' => 380
               }, 'DateTime::Duration' );

You can't say with only these informations how many days it is. This is the
problem: we cannot use DateTime::Duration for telling us how many days there
are
between two dates.
I think we can use Date::Calc::Delta_Days for this (and Delta_DHMS for
hours_between).
